我的系统为rh9+sendmail+squirrelmail,可以发信到其他网站的信箱,但是不能接收
我的系统为rh9+sendmail+squirrelmail,可以发信到其他网站的信箱,但是不能接收其他网站发过来的信件,局域网内用户可以互相收发信件<br><br>
<br>
在公网上我用的是动态域名6v.oicp.net,在局域网内的邮件服务器名为6v,用宽带路由器做dmz映射, <br>
用域名和主机名都可以以web方式登入邮箱。 <br>
我现在设置了两个帐户lyf和lyf1,密码lyf <br>
<br>
我在web方式登录,用帐户lyf发邮件,结果如下: <br>
在局域网中,在其他客户机上,用6v登入lyf发邮件给lyf1◎6v,可以成功。用6v登入lyf发邮件给lyf◎6v.oicp.net,可以成功。用6v.oicp.net登入lyf发邮件给lyf◎6v.oicp.net,不能成功。 <br>
<br>
在公网中,我用6v.oicp.net登入lyf发邮件给lyf1◎6v.oicp.net不能成功,用其他网站的邮箱发邮件给lyf1◎6v.oicp.net也不能成功 <br>
<br>
<br>
<br>
<br>
我用其他网站的信箱发lyf@动态IP,也不能收到。这里好像与dns无关了 <br>
<br>
我在公网上可以用动态域名打开邮箱的web页面,我想我的宽带路由器的dmz映射是成功的 <br>
<br>
用nslookup -sil 6v.oicp可以解析出我在公网上的ip, <br>
然后用nslookup -sil 公网上的Ip,不能逆向解析出我的动态域名 <br>
<br>
我用用户名@IP的格式发邮件应该是不受dns的影响的,我的邮箱似乎不能收到本地域以外的邮件,请老大赶快救我,我快被折磨死了 <br>
<br>
<br>
re:SMN:iloveyoulsmxx@ya...
SMN:iloveyoulsmxx@yahoo.com.cn QQ:29689070re:我以前使用的是sendmail+动态域名...
我以前使用的是sendmail+动态域名<br>根据我对日志的观察对方如果要发邮件给你首先会对你@XXXX后面的XXXX进行MX记录解析,如果能够解析的到那么投递到解析出来的IP,如果不行则认为不可达,退回.<br>
比如 如果你用123@abc.com去发给123@163.com邮件 那么首先abc.com会对163.com做MX记录查询得到他的IP地址220.181.12.14然后只要abc.com这台邮件服务器可以访问外网那么他就会去smtp对方,然后以123@abc.com的名义发出去邮件<br>
<br>
反之如果123@163.com要给123@abc.com发邮件首先163.com也会对abc.com去做MX解析,如果abc.com不是公网上有效地域名,那么邮件服务器则会认为对方不存在而退信,楼主所说后面跟IP,那么后面也是会将IP做MX解析的<br>
我曾经被这个问题折磨的够呛.<br><br>
所以要想对方能够给你发信,那么你要有能够被对方DNS解析到的MX记录才行<br>
页:
[1]